Chestnut Pesto

Ingredients

  • 150 g chestnut (s), cooked
  • 1 handful basil
  • salt
  • olive oil
  • 1 clove garlic

Instructions

  1. Puree the cooked chestnuts with basil, garlic and a little olive oil until everything is fine. Then season with salt and fill up with olive oil depending on the desired consistency.
  2. If you want to eat the pesto with pasta, add enough olive oil to create a creamy sauce that is easy to stir into the pasta.
  3. For a dip or with fried foods, the consistency can be a little firmer and a little firmer if you want to enjoy it straight or with bread.
  4. If you want to keep the pesto a little longer, it should be a little more salted. Store covered with oil in a closed glass in a cool and dark place. It lasts about 14 days, maybe a little longer, just see if it`s still good.
  5. You can also prepare the pesto with fresh goat cheese or chives to vary it.
